Threat Risk: Medium
Victim: District of Columbia Public Schools (DCPS)
Incident: Unauthorized access to student information databases.
Impact: Potential exposure of sensitive student PII leading to privacy violations or identity theft.
Attacker: Unidentified threat actors
Analysis: The District of Columbia Public Schools (DCPS) experienced a data breach that potentially exposed student records. This incident underscores the targeting of educational institutions due to the high volume of personally identifiable information (PII) they maintain. The breach highlights critical gaps in the protection of sensitive administrative databases.
Recommendations: Implement multi-factor authentication (MFA) across all student and staff portals.; Conduct a comprehensive audit of access controls for sensitive student databases.; Deploy enhanced monitoring for unauthorized data exfiltration attempts.
